Homemade Brownies Recipe

The brownie is one of the easiest and quickest vegan recipes to prepare. By substituting a couple of ingredients from the traditional recipe we can get a fudgy, sweet, and much healthier vegan brownie. Why is the vegan brownie healthier? First of all, this recipe eliminates butter, a dairy derivative that is loaded with saturated fat and cholesterol. It also replaces the egg, which is high in cholesterol despite being rich in protein.

If you want to get an even healthier version of your vegan dessert, you can try preparing your vegan brownie without sugar. We have used Splenda, a natural sweetener much healthier than sugar, but you can do without any sweetener in this recipe. It won’t taste as sweet, but you’ll still get a delicious dessert.

This version of the traditional chocolate brownie is prepared with oat flour, although you can select a specially grown oat flour to make it gluten-free. Oats have a protein whose structure is very similar to that of gluten, so it is possible to cause intolerance. However, there are many gluten-free oat flour options on the market today. Ingredients to make brownies:

  •     5 tablespoons of oat flour.
  •     2 tablespoons of cocoa powder
  •     1 glass of soymilk or almond milk
  •     1 teaspoon of chemical yeast (baking powder)
  •     1 handful of walnuts
  •     1 handful of dried cranberries
  •     1 dessertspoonful of Splenda or stevia
  •     1 tablespoon of olive oil
  •     1 dessert spoon vanilla essence

How to make brownies:

  1. Incorporate the previously sifted oat flour and baking powder or baking powder in a bowl.
  2. Add the cocoa powder and stir well to integrate the dry ingredients.
  3. Add the olive oil, soy milk, and vanilla essence. Mix vigorously until all ingredients are integrated and you have your vegan brownie batter.
  4. Place the batter in an ovenproof pan and decorate the vegan brownie with walnuts and blueberries to your liking. Bake it at 170 ºC for 20 minutes. (source : ineskohl.info )
  5. You can also prepare your vegan brownie in the microwave. With 2 minutes at maximum power would be enough. This will depend on each microwave, as some may need a little more time, so keep an eye on it. You can also take advantage and prepare your vegan brownie in a cup instead of using a mold.
